Overcoming Challenges in Blockchain Development

Blockchain development presents several significant challenges, particularly for individuals who lack advanced technical expertise. Traditional platforms often require a deep understanding of complex coding languages, cryptography, and the intricate architecture of smart contracts, making it difficult for non-experts to engage. These high barriers to entry discourage many potential contributors, limiting the development and growth of decentralized applications (dApps). The development process is often slow, complicated, and prone to errors, creating additional risks and delays that hinder the technology’s broader adoption.

Qubetics' Solutions with QubeQode IDE and AI Tools

Qubetics addresses these challenges head-on with its QubeQode IDE. Designed to be both powerful and accessible, QubeQode features a drag-and-drop interface that simplifies the design and development process. Developers can easily utilize pre-built components to create applications without getting bogged down by intricate coding. The IDE offers a form-based configuration system that allows users to define the parameters of smart contracts through intuitive forms. This means that even those with limited technical experience can build functional applications quickly and efficiently.

Real-World Problem-Solving with QubeQode IDE

By lowering the technical barriers, QubeQode empowers a broader audience to engage with blockchain, including those who may have previously been intimidated by its complexity. Security is another critical area where QubeQode excels. The platform integrates AI-powered vulnerability checks that automatically identify potential risks, ensuring that smart contracts are secure. This proactive approach to security reduces the likelihood of breaches, protecting developers from potential financial losses and building trust in the applications they create. Additionally, QubeQode significantly improves the speed of blockchain application creation, with AI-driven tools that automatically optimize and auto-correct code, streamlining the development cycle and enabling faster project completion.
